Output 91d83891e965d25a0de25e08c26432c5778b6236e03e58fad80df24313516c05:0

value
22062661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a9d5bcf65c0ed35eb17dabb77321f803ec81dcc OP_EQUAL
address
32f9Bvz6WiDyqwEvgvqdbhsS9CcUuNKBVu
transaction
91d83891e965d25a0de25e08c26432c5778b6236e03e58fad80df24313516c05